How do people choose a name for their child? Researchers have long noted that the overall popularity of a name exerts a strong influence on people's preferences—more popular names, such as Robert or Susan, are more frequent and, by their sheer ubiquity, drive more parents to adopt a similar choice. However, new research by psychologists at New York University and Indiana University, Bloomington suggests that the change in popularity of a name over time increasingly influences naming decisions in the United States.

By examining data from a 20-year-old clinical trial, a research team based at the MassGeneral Institute for Neurodegenerative Diseases (MGH-MIND) and Harvard School of Public Health (HSPH), has found evidence supporting the findings of their 2008 study – that elevated levels of the antioxidant urate may slow the progression of Parkinson's disease.

Individuals with Parkinson's disease who have higher levels of a metabolite called urate in their blood and in cerebrospinal fluid (CSF) have a slower rate of disease progression, according to a study funded by the National Institutes of Health. A clinical trial is under way to examine the safety and potential benefits of supplemental urate elevation for recently diagnosed Parkinson's patients who have low urate levels.

Chinese-speaking children with dyslexia have a disorder that is distinctly different, and perhaps more complicated and severe, than that of English speakers. Those differences can be seen in the brain and in the performance of Chinese children on visual and oral language tasks, reveals a report published online on October 12th in Current Biology, a Cell Press publication.

St. Louis, Oct. 8, 2009 — Spontaneous brain activity formerly thought to be "white noise" measurably changes after a person learns a new task, researchers at Washington University School of Medicine in St. Louis and the University of Chieti, Italy, have shown.

Scientists also report that the degree of change reflects how well subjects have learned to perform the task. Their study is published online this week in the Proceedings of the National Academy of Sciences.

A sophisticated computational algorithm, applied to a large set of gene markers, has achieved greater accuracy than conventional methods in assessing individual risk for type 1 diabetes.

A research team led by Hakon Hakonarson, M.D., Ph.D., director of the Center for Applied Genomics at The Children's Hospital of Philadelphia, suggests that their technique, applied to appropriate complex multigenic diseases, improves the prospects for personalizing medicine to an individual's genetic profile. The study appears in the October 9 issue of the online journal PLoS Genetics.
